Latest Patents

One of her latest patents is titled "Methods of treating autoimmune disease using a domain antibody directed against CD40L." This patent outlines methods for treating various autoimmune diseases, including primary immune thrombocytopenia (ITP), solid organ transplant rejection, graft-related disease, pemphigus vulgaris, systemic sclerosis, and myasthenia gravis. The invention involves antibody polypeptides that specifically bind to human CD40L without activating platelets. The methods may include at least one administration cycle with a dose ranging from about 75 mg to about 1500 mg, aimed at normalizing platelet counts in patients.

Another significant patent is "Method of using antibody polypeptides that antagonize CD40 to treat IBD." This patent describes a method for treating inflammatory bowel disease (IBD) through the administration of an antibody polypeptide that specifically binds to a novel epitope of human CD40. The antibody polypeptides in this method do not exhibit CD40 agonist activity and may consist of fusions of a domain antibody (dAb) comprising a single Vor Vdomain and an Fc domain.
